What is the CE certification EN55032 standard?

Views :
Update time : 2024-10-22

en55032 is one of the international standards for electromagnetic emissions from electronic products. This standard defines the emission limits of electromagnetic radiation produced by electronic products during operation and specifies the methods and procedures for evaluating electromagnetic radiation. The en55032 standard is widely used in the European market and is essential for the compliance and market access of electronic products.

 

According to the requirements of the EN55032 standard, the electromagnetic emissions of electronic products should be limited within specific frequency ranges. This is to protect electromagnetic compatibility and prevent electronic products from causing interference with surrounding devices and environments. The standard specifies radiation limits for different frequency ranges and provides measurement methods and requirements for evaluating emissions. Electronic products that comply with the EN55032 standard ensure that their radiation levels are within safe and compliant limits.

 

To meet the EN55032 standard, manufacturers of electronic products need to conduct electromagnetic radiation testing and evaluation. This includes using specialized testing equipment and methods to determine the radiation levels of products under different operating conditions. Through compliant testing and evaluation, manufacturers can ensure that their products meet the EN55032 standard, thereby improving their market competitiveness and usability.
